• 【leetcode】1296. Divide Array in Sets of K Consecutive Numbers


    题目如下:

    Given an array of integers nums and a positive integer k, find whether it's possible to divide this array into sets of k consecutive numbers
    Return True if its possible otherwise return False.

    Example 1:

    Input: nums = [1,2,3,3,4,4,5,6], k = 4
    Output: true
    Explanation: Array can be divided into [1,2,3,4] and [3,4,5,6].
    

    Example 2:

    Input: nums = [3,2,1,2,3,4,3,4,5,9,10,11], k = 3
    Output: true
    Explanation: Array can be divided into [1,2,3] , [2,3,4] , [3,4,5] and [9,10,11].
    

    Example 3:

    Input: nums = [3,3,2,2,1,1], k = 3
    Output: true
    

    Example 4:

    Input: nums = [1,2,3,4], k = 3
    Output: false
    Explanation: Each array should be divided in subarrays of size 3. 

    Constraints:

    • 1 <= nums.length <= 10^5
    • 1 <= nums[i] <= 10^9
    • 1 <= k <= nums.length

    解题思路:从nums中最小的数字开始,依次往后找k-1个数字,找到一个就从nums删除掉对应的一个数字,直到nums为空,或者找不到符合条件的数字为止。

    代码如下:

    class Solution(object):
        def isPossibleDivide(self, nums, k):
            """
            :type nums: List[int]
            :type k: int
            :rtype: bool
            """
            import bisect
            nums.sort()
            while len(nums) > 0:
                head = nums.pop(0)
                tk = k - 1
                val = head + 1
                while tk > 0:
                    inx = bisect.bisect_left(nums,val)
                    if inx >= 0 and inx < len(nums) and nums[inx] == val:
                        tk -= 1
                        val += 1
                        del nums[inx]
                        continue
                    return False
            return tk == 0
